We're seeking a skilled Employee Relations & HR Advisor to join our client's People Team. In this varied and crucial role, you'll be the go-to expert for complex employee matters, ensuring fairness, consistency, and compliance across the organisation.
Key responsibilities:
Provide expert, timely, and professional advice on a full range of employee relations issues, including disciplinary, grievance, performance management, conflict resolution, and absence cases.
Coach and guide managers through ER cases from start to finish, ensuring fair, timely, and legally compliant outcomes in line with internal policies.
Build strong, proactive relationships with managers and employees across the business.
Work closely with People Team colleagues to ensure consistency and alignment in HR practices.
Provide comprehensive guidance to employees and managers on flexible working requests, ensuring compliance with statutory and internal requirements.
Advise on and support the process for all family leave entitlements, including maternity, paternity, shared parental, adoption, and carer's leave.
